Job Description

University Physicians Association is seeking a compassionate and skilled Registered Nurse to join our University Palliative Care team. This role is ideal for a nurse who thrives in a collaborative, patient-centered environment and is passionate about improving quality of life for patients with serious illnesses. The position is based within the UT Medical Center Cancer Institute and involves close coordination with physicians, patients, and families to deliver holistic, supportive care.

Key Responsibilities

  • Conduct comprehensive patient assessments, including physical, emotional, and psychosocial evaluations.
  • Support symptom management, medication reconciliation, and patient education.
  • Collaborate with interdisciplinary teams to develop and implement individualized care plans.
  • Facilitate as appropriate advance care planning discussions and goals-of-care conversations.
  • Coordinate outpatient services including scheduling, prior authorizations, and follow-up care.
  • Communicate test results and care updates to patients and families with empathy and clarity.
  • Provide triage support for urgent medical issues during clinic hours and on a rotating basis.
  • Maintain accurate documentation in the electronic health record (EHR).
  • Assist inpatient service with triage and phone coverage as needed.
  • Build trusting relationships with patients and families, offering emotional support and guidance.
